DocumentCode
710161
Title
The XDa-TA system for automated grading of SQL query assignments
Author
Bhangdiya, Amol ; Chandra, Bikash ; Kar, Biplab ; Radhakrishnan, Bharath ; Reddy, K. V. Maheshwara ; Shah, Shetal ; Sudarshan, S.
Author_Institution
IIT Bombay, Mumbai, India
fYear
2015
fDate
13-17 April 2015
Firstpage
1468
Lastpage
1471
Abstract
Grading of student SQL queries is usually done by executing the query on sample datasets (which may be unable to catch many errors) and/or by manually comparing/checking a student query with the correct query (which can be tedious and error prone). In this demonstration we present the XDa-TA system which can be used by instructors and TAs for grading SQL query assignments automatically. Given one or more correct queries for an SQL assignment, the tool uses the XData system to automatically generate datasets that are designed specifically to catch common errors. The grading is then done by comparing the results of student queries with those of the correct queries against these generated datasets; instructors can optionally provide additional datasets for testing. The tool can also be used in a learning mode by students, where it can provide immediate feedback with hints explaining possible reasons for erroneous output. This tool could be of great value to instructors particularly, to instructors of MOOCs.
Keywords
SQL; computer aided instruction; query processing; MOOC; SQL query assignment; XDa-TA system; learning mode; query execution; sample dataset generation; student query checking; Database systems; Linear systems; Manuals; Remuneration; Syntactics; Testing;
fLanguage
English
Publisher
ieee
Conference_Titel
Data Engineering (ICDE), 2015 IEEE 31st International Conference on
Conference_Location
Seoul
Type
conf
DOI
10.1109/ICDE.2015.7113403
Filename
7113403
Link To Document